What is the Process of Drug Rehab

Whatever drug rehabilitation option in Dallas is chosen, the process of drug rehab almost always begins with a drug detox. Drug detoxification is often supervised by medical professionals and trained personnel at the detoxification facility or drug treatment facility. Medical staff will help ease withdrawal symptoms during the detoxification period and make this step of the process as smooth and comfortable as possible. Individuals going through detoxification will typically have extreme cravings for their drug or drugs or choice and relapse if likely if not in a drug rehabilitation setting

After the physical withdrawal symptoms have subsided, the next steps of the process of drug rehab include dealing with any and all underlying emotional and psychological barriers to sobriety. This can be very different from person to person, and most drug rehabilitation centers incorporate behavioral therapy as well as group and individualized counseling to ensure that all issues are resolved. This will ensure that the individual is able to return to a healthy and sober lifestyle once treatment is complete. Part of the process of drug rehab is ensuring that the person is set up for success once treatment is complete, and treatment counselors will often develop aftercare programs with the individual to ensure they remain clean and sober for the long term.

Drug Rehab and Detoxification for Withdrawal Symptoms

One of the reasons drug addicted individuals find it extremely hard to stop using drugs once they start using them, is because of physical and psychological dependency that inevitably develops if the person uses them long enough. It no longer becomes a matter of "willpower" because their bodies and minds will actually punish them both physically and mentally if they stop using drugs. This is called drug withdrawal, and is a major roadblock for individuals who wish to stop using drugs. Individuals often become very ill during withdrawal and can even die in in some cases, as seizures and strokes can occur with certain drugs and with alcohol. Depression is a very typical withdrawal symptom, which can become so extreme that an individual may commit suicide.

To minimize certain withdrawal symptoms and to make detox a safer process, it is suggested that drug addicted individuals who wish to quit do so in a suitable setting such as a drug rehab center. Drug treatment facilities in Dallas can not only see individuals safely through the detox process and help alleviate and relieve withdrawal symptoms, but also ensure that the individual doesn't relapse back into drug use. After detoxification has been accomplished, addiction professionals in Dallas will then ensure that all underlying psychological and emotional issues tied to the individual's addiction are addressed so that they can remain clean and sober once they leave the drug rehabilitation center.

How Much Does a Drug Treatment Program Cost?

It can be hard enough to get someone to want help and agree to enter a drug rehab facility in Dallas. Finding the money to pay for drug rehab can often be a problem, but one that can be overcome if one looks at the many possibilities available in Dallas. Depending on which drug rehab option is chosen, the cost of drug rehab can vary considerably from program to program. Some outpatient and short term drug rehab facilitiescenters]]] for example may be state or federally funded and may even be free of charge. These types of facilities are also usually the least effective however, a fact which should be considered over cost.

More long term drug rehab programs in Dallas which have proven to be the most effective are residential and inpatient drug treatment facilities which require a stay of at least 90 days. These types of drug rehab centers are typically more costly due to the fact that these facilities are private drug treatment centers and supply their clients with all food and shelter for the duration of their stay. These programs typically cost anywhere from $4000 to $20,000, depending on the length of stay and the amenities offered.

How Long is a Drug Rehabilitation Program in Dallas?

Individuals progress through Drug Rehab in Dallas at different rates, so there is no way that an exact pre-determined length for drug rehab can be set .However, research has shown unequivocally that the recovery success rate is much higher in long term residential Drug Rehabilitation than in short term drug rehabilitation. Generally, for inpatient or outpatient Drug Rehab in Dallas, participation for less than 90 days delivers a very limited amount of effectiveness, and treatment lasting longer is advisable for achieving the most positive results. The reason that a longer duration of drug rehabilitation is highly recommended is because it takes time to physically rejuvenate from drugs and lower drug cravings. It also takes time for the addict's brain to begin to heal. A longer Drug Rehab Program in Dallas, IA. also gives the addict time to be able to sort out the underlying issues of why they began to use drugs to begin with. Long term Drug Rehabilitation is recommended because it takes time for the addict to adopt new behaviors and skills and to be educated in relapse prevention.
